    It's about young love, probably young teenagers, on the beach and learning about love and kissing for the first time. He is making promises to her and basking in the magic of young love.
    "You took the words right out of my mouth" refers to once they started kissing, it was so good that he couldn't bring himself to break it to speak. No words, just kisses.
